Vivendi is auctioning its US entertainment operations. A buyer will be selected in September 2003. The French conglomerate is cleverly giving the impression there is intense rivalry for the assets, which comprise a film studio, cable-TV stations and a theme park. The following five groups are known to be bidding: NBC; ex-Seagram head Edgar Bronfman; MGM; Viacom; and Liberty Media. Private equity groups firms such as Texas Pacific Group and Carlyle Group are playing a part in the auction. MGM and Liberty Media have been thought most likely to win the bid.
